
Retiring Isle of Man Sport Chairman Geoff Karran fears current financial problems for the Isle of Man could hit funding for sport.
He says part of the success story over the past decade is directly linked to money contributed by Government and the private sector.
It helps athletes go away to compete and raise their standards.
